|
|
@ -386,6 +386,7 @@
|
|
|
|
$scope.data.wordpress = $scope.defaultData.wordpress;
|
|
|
|
$scope.data.wordpress = $scope.defaultData.wordpress;
|
|
|
|
$scope.data.drupal = $scope.defaultData.drupal;
|
|
|
|
$scope.data.drupal = $scope.defaultData.drupal;
|
|
|
|
$scope.data.magento = $scope.defaultData.magento;
|
|
|
|
$scope.data.magento = $scope.defaultData.magento;
|
|
|
|
|
|
|
|
$scope.data.python = $scope.defaultData.python;
|
|
|
|
$scope.data.proxy = $scope.defaultData.proxy;
|
|
|
|
$scope.data.proxy = $scope.defaultData.proxy;
|
|
|
|
$scope.data.index = $scope.defaultData.index;
|
|
|
|
$scope.data.index = $scope.defaultData.index;
|
|
|
|
$scope.data.fallback_html = $scope.defaultData.fallback_html;
|
|
|
|
$scope.data.fallback_html = $scope.defaultData.fallback_html;
|
|
|
@ -413,7 +414,6 @@
|
|
|
|
$scope.data.magento = true;
|
|
|
|
$scope.data.magento = true;
|
|
|
|
break;
|
|
|
|
break;
|
|
|
|
case 'nodejs':
|
|
|
|
case 'nodejs':
|
|
|
|
$scope.data.php = false;
|
|
|
|
|
|
|
|
$scope.data.proxy = true;
|
|
|
|
$scope.data.proxy = true;
|
|
|
|
break;
|
|
|
|
break;
|
|
|
|
}
|
|
|
|
}
|
|
|
@ -624,6 +624,17 @@
|
|
|
|
$scope.data.php = false;
|
|
|
|
$scope.data.php = false;
|
|
|
|
}
|
|
|
|
}
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
// toggle proxy <-> (PHP || Python)
|
|
|
|
|
|
|
|
if ($scope.data.proxy && !oldValue.proxy) {
|
|
|
|
|
|
|
|
$scope.data.php = false;
|
|
|
|
|
|
|
|
$scope.data.python = false;
|
|
|
|
|
|
|
|
} else if (
|
|
|
|
|
|
|
|
($scope.data.php && !oldValue.php) ||
|
|
|
|
|
|
|
|
($scope.data.python && !oldValue.python)
|
|
|
|
|
|
|
|
) {
|
|
|
|
|
|
|
|
$scope.data.proxy = false;
|
|
|
|
|
|
|
|
}
|
|
|
|
|
|
|
|
|
|
|
|
// default index file
|
|
|
|
// default index file
|
|
|
|
if (!$scope.data.php) {
|
|
|
|
if (!$scope.data.php) {
|
|
|
|
$scope.defaultData.index = 'index.html';
|
|
|
|
$scope.defaultData.index = 'index.html';
|
|
|
|